What happens to SWR bandwidth when one or more loading coils are used to resonate an electrically short antenna?
It is increased
It is decreased✓Correct answer
It is unchanged if the loading coil is located at the feed point
It is unchanged if the loading coil is located at a voltage maximum point
Explanation
A loading coil restores resonance at one frequency by cancelling a reactance that changes very rapidly with frequency on a short antenna. That rapid change is high Q, so the range over which SWR stays low narrows, no matter where the coil is placed.
